Madras University Urge Colleges to Pay Rs 25,000 as Affiliation Fee By March 15; Check Details Here


New Delhi: The University of Madras has issued a circular asking affiliated schools to pay the 'continuation of provisional affiliation fee' for each programme they provide from 2016-17 to 2020-21. The fee must be submitted before March 15.

According to the Registrar's circular, institutions must pay 25,000 per course, per section, for every programme they provide, including certificate, diploma, and UG and PG professional courses. Colleges must pay the fee online from the fourth year of UG and the third year of PG. 

The decision was taken by Madras University after a local fund audit revealed that, despite the rule demanding the affiliation fee, it had not been collected. 

Some top university officials pointed out that the legislation did not clearly provide that colleges should be charged an ongoing affiliation fee and that it was only a one-time fee until the first batch finished its course. 

The authorities said they could not have made such a mistake since it would have compromised the institution's earnings.

Vice-Chancellor S. Gowri, on the other hand, appointed a senior syndicate member to investigate the statute. The V-C stated that the member, who had previously served in the government, had said that the university had not collected the fee as a result of it. The dues received from the colleges will assist the institution get through its current financial problems.
